Project Description
King's North Connection is a 10.8 km, 36-inch natural gas pipeline extending from an Enbridge facility in Etobicoke to the TCPL Vaughan Mainline Expansion in Vaughan. The corridor crossed a highly developed area with existing infrastructure, high-value properties, future land-development projects, and the Highway 427 expansion.
TULLOCH provided legal, construction, as-built, and environmental survey support. Work included right-of-way and workspace layout, directional-drill alignment, settlement monitoring for five bored sections, drafting, and data processing.
Scope of Services
- Legal surveys along the pipeline corridor
- Construction surveys for right-of-way, ditch line, temporary workspaces, engineering features, and directional-drill alignments
- As-built pipeline surveys and survey support for environmental requirements
- Settlement monitoring for five bored sections
- Drafting and data-processing support
